From Fields To Global Markets: How Netsurit’s IT Solutions Empowered Groep 91’s Agricultural Transformation

Background

Groep 91, a family-owned agricultural enterprise, is a prominent player in South Africa’s citrus and macadamia industry. Managing production, packing, and export of high-quality produce to global markets, they operate from the rural Letsitele region in Limpopo Province. Despite their success, the digital age introduced operational challenges that demanded advanced IT solutions to maintain competitiveness and efficiency.

Netsurit, a leader in IT management and solutions, partnered with Groep 91 to modernise their technology infrastructure, addressing unique regional challenges and enabling the business to thrive in the global agricultural supply chain.

Challenges

Operating in a rural environment presented several IT-related challenges:

  • Connectivity Issues: The remote location made establishing stable and reliable network connections difficult.
  • Frequent Downtime: Unreliable power supply and inadequate IT support disrupted operations.
  • Inadequate IT Solutions: Previous service providers failed to deliver systems suited to the unique requirements of rural farming.
  • Data Management Needs: Groep 91’s growing reliance on data-driven agriculture required advanced systems for monitoring and decision-making.

Solution

Netsurit implemented a comprehensive IT overhaul tailored to Groep 91’s specific needs:

  1. Stable Connectivity: A reliable network infrastructure was established, overcoming regional limitations.
  2. Reduced Downtime: Advanced power backup systems, including uninterruptible power supplies (UPS), were installed to counteract power outages.
  3. Rapid IT Support: A dedicated support team was deployed to address IT issues quickly, minimising disruptions.
  4. Data Integration: Scalable IT solutions were introduced to manage and analyse agricultural data, enhancing decision-making.
  5. Enhanced IT Ecosystem: Smart devices and cloud-based systems were implemented to improve efficiency and streamline processes between farm operations and export logistics.
